Session

No More YAML Soup: Taking Control with Dagger's Pipeline-as-Code Philosophy

In today's fast-paced software development landscape, maintaining complex, YAML-based CI/CD pipelines can become a bottleneck, leading to what many developers lament as "YAML Soup". This talk proposes a revolutionary shift with the adoption of Dagger, developed by Solomon Hykes's team, which replaces traditional, error-prone scripting with a robust, language-agnostic API and cross-language scripting engine. This session aims to demonstrate how Dagger enables developers to write their pipelines as code directly within the language of their project, thereby enhancing readability, maintainability, and scalability.

We will start with an overview of Dagger, discussing its core concepts and advantages over traditional pipeline configurations. The presentation will include a detailed walkthrough of transitioning from a YAML-based pipeline to a Dagger-based setup, illustrating the process with real-world examples and best practices.

Koray Oksay

Kubernetes Consultant @Kubermatic

Istanbul, Turkey

Actions

Please note that Sessionize is not responsible for the accuracy or validity of the data provided by speakers. If you suspect this profile to be fake or spam, please let us know.

Jump to top